We are seeking a Biomedical Engineering Technician II to:


* Diagnose and perform repairs on medical equipment in both shop and critical care settings-including operating rooms, trauma units, emergency rooms, and other patient care areas-ensuring timely service to minimize downtime.


* Maintain accurate records of all maintenance activities performed on assigned medical equipment and promptly update the department database with complete service documentation.
